The crime index for Ampang district declined by 14.25 percent from January to November this year.
Selangor police chief Datuk Abdul Samah Mat said the number of cases dropped to 2,949 from 3,439 cases over the corresponding period last year.
"The decline is the result of good cooperation between the police and the community," he said after the handing over of duty by Ampang Jaya police chief SAC Khairuldin Saad to his successor ACP Hamzah Alias here, yesterday.
Abdul Samah said the community policing programme should be enhanced as the public has an important role in helping to solve crime related issues.
"Develop strategies to curb criminal activities. The community policing concept has served us well," he added.
